I know there are people who prefer the medium version. It was my first choice too when I went to the store. But it felt awkwardly small on my wrists when I tried them. 35mm seems to be too small given the square case shape, compared to a 36mm Datejust which looks and feels right. So I settled for large. It’s still looks good with a lot of strap seen from the top of the wrist thanks to the prominent square shape. A sign that it’s not too big for me.

There’s a lot to like in this model. It’s definitely slim enough to go under the cuff. The case is curved and sits nicely on the top of my wrist. Felt like I’m wearing nothing. The leather strap is soft and comfortable. No comment on the bracelet yet as it is currently sized to my wife’s wrist (we’re sharing). But putting back the links is fast due to the mechanism.



Dial may be plain and textureless aside from the painted markers but it’s made out of opaline. This opaque glass material is pleasing to the eye and has little glittering speckles when closely inspected.
